CAPAC is Canada’s largest and longest established performing rights organization. It's been around for over 50 years — a lot longer than the film business in Canada! Its main job is to collect performing rights royalties from the people who use music, and distribute the money to the people who compose and publish it.
CAPAC composers and publishers produce nearly all the music for made-inCanada motion pictures (and for the majority of Canadian television shows, too). And many of CAPAC’s 8,000 writermembers contribute to the scores of films made in Europe and the United States.
